5 out of 14 petitions were instantly provided with solutions during the online meeting.
Coimbatore: The Grievance Meeting which is held every Monday is headed by the Coimbatore District Collector G S Sameeran who meets residents of every taluk through an online conference.
The Grievance Meeting held on Monday was for Kinathukadavu taluk residents. Durimg the meeting, the District Backward Class and Minority Group Welfare Coordinator, Amsaveni received petitions of people living in Kinathukadavu. A total of 14 petitions - 3 for Natham Patta, 2 for Natham Patta copies and 9 pattas for plots were received.
“The three Natham patta and 2 natham patta copies were analyzed and solutions were provided instantly, while demands for patta of plots were being investigated and eligible persons will be provided with assistance and solutions," assured Revenue Department officials.
Kinatukadavu Tahsildar Sasirekha, Social Security Project Tahsildar Kanakeswari, Deputy Tahsildar Kumari Ananthan and Kinatukadavu Mandal Tahsildar Sivakumar and other Revenue officials were present during the online meeting.
